Cell C CEO resigns
Douglas Craigie Stevenson has resigned as CEO of Cell C, effective 31 March 2023.
Blue Label Telecoms, a major publicly-traded stakeholder in Cell C, informed shareholders of Craigie Stevenson’s resignation via the JSE news service.

Cell C appoints Chief Restructuring Officer
Cell C has appointed Brett Copans to the newly created role of chief restructuring officer.
The operator said the aim of his role is to ensure the prudent and efficient use of resources, and allocating funding to high-value opportunities.

Cell C lenders vote to take 80% loss on their debt to save company
Cell C's secured lenders, who formerly held publicly listed bonds or notes, have voted in favour of a compromise cash-out offer of 20c for every R1 of debt.
